Digital Images Encryption in Spatial Domain Based on Singular Value Decomposition and Cellular Automata

Protection of digital images from unauthorized access is the main purpose of this paper. A reliable approach to encrypt a digital image in spatial domain is presented here. Our algorithm is based on the singular value decomposition and one dimensional cellular automata. First, we calculate the singular value decomposition (SVD) of the original image in which the features of the image are extracted and then pushed them into the one dimensional cellular automata to generate the robust secret key for the image authentication. SVD is used as a strong mathematical tool to decompose a digital image into three orthogonal matrices and create features that are rotation invariant. We applied our proposed model on one hundred number of JPEG RGB images of size 800 × 800. The experimental results have illustrated the robustness, visual quality and reliability of our proposed algorithm.
